Family Plan Question

Hello, I was hoping to purchase 2 phones from amazon and have both
activated under a Family Plan.  However theres a new RIM Blackberry
phone that I heard about that supposedly will be coming out soon that
would really fit my needs, so in the meantime could I just order 1
phone from amazon + a $39 plan, then at a later date when the new
phone finally becomes available order that phone and switch both over
to a Family Plan without penalty? Or will I be stuck under the
contract I started with? Thanks for any info!
I have a life - 18 Sep 2004 17:28 GMT
Yes you can start with one...  and combine new line and old into family
later, you may have to extend for toal of one year at that time again...
